American Indians, also known as Native Americans, do not have and did not have any restriction...In 1896, George Gustav Heye (1874–1957), a mining engineer, began collecting Native American artifacts while working in Arizona. Soon an avid collector, Heye founded the Museum of the American Indian in New York City in 1916, and it opened to the public in 1922 at Audubon Terrace. National Museum of the American Indian New York Alexander Hamilton U.S. Custom House One Bowling Green New York, NY 10004 The National Museum of the American Indian on the National Mall in Washington, D.C., opened on September 21, 2004, on Fourth Street and Independence Avenue, Southwest. The George Gustav Heye Center, a permanent museum, is located at the Alexander Hamilton U.S. Custom House in New York City, opened in October of 1994.21 hours ago · The museum is open every day, except December 25, from 10:00 a.m. to 5:30 p.m. Admission is free and no tickets are required. The NMAI’s current holdings have their foundation in the collection of the former Museum of the American Indian (MAI), Heye Foundation, of New York City, assembled largely by George Gustav Heye (1874–1957). From his first acquisition, the 1897 purchase of a Navajo hide shirt in Arizona, Heye’s collecting ...
